DoorDash stock target raised to $215 by Raymond James

On Wednesday, Raymond (NSE:RYMD) James increased the price target for DoorDash Inc. (NASDAQ:DASH) to $215 from the previous $170, while maintaining an Outperform rating on the shares. The company, now valued at over $80 billion, has seen its stock surge 63% over the past year, trading near $193. The firm’s analyst highlighted DoorDash’s strong performance, noting the company’s successful beat and its continued impressive execution. The analyst praised DoorDash for reinvesting efficiency gains back into the business, which has helped to improve scale. The report emphasized DoorDash’s healthy user growth, with monthly active users (MAUs), DashPass subscriptions, and new verticals growing by 14%, 22%, and 42%, respectively. Additionally, DoorDash’s international business was noted to have grown by 40%, with a two-year compound annual growth rate (CAGR) exceeding 50%. The analyst was particularly encouraged by the profitability updates, which included total incremental margins of 5.6% and an EBITDA growth of over 50%. DoorDash’s financial results were reported to have surpassed expectations, with gross order volume (GOV) and EBITDA coming in 2% and less than 1% ahead, respectively. The first-quarter GOV outlook was positively received, and the EBITDA guidance for the year was set between $550 million to $600 million, which closely brackets the Street’s estimate of $583 million. Analyst consensus remains bullish, with targets ranging from $138 to $240 per share. The analyst also noted the positive commentary around Dasher supply and the confidence expressed by DoorDash regarding improvements in international markets and new business verticals.

The analysis by Raymond James suggests that DoorDash is positioned for continued growth, with untapped profit potential in international markets and new verticals that are expected to follow the progression of the U.S. restaurant business. The company’s ability to maintain a healthy growth trajectory and its positive outlook for the first quarter were key factors in the firm’s decision to raise the price target. In other recent news, DoorDash Inc. has been highlighted by several analytical firms following its recent financial performance. BofA Securities, for instance, raised the company’s stock price target from $205 to $245, acknowledging DoorDash’s gross order value (GOV), revenue, and EBITDA figures that met or surpassed market expectations. JPMorgan also increased DoorDash’s stock target to $205, citing confidence in the company’s growth and profitability. The firm noted DoorDash’s record 42 million Monthly Active Users (MAUs) and its expanding services beyond restaurant delivery.

BTIG analysts, in turn, raised their outlook on DoorDash, increasing the price target to $225 from $200, impressed by the company’s robust growth and margin performance. Goldman Sachs also adjusted its outlook on DoorDash, raising the price target to $212, focusing on the company’s progress in expanding its platform beyond restaurant delivery. Lastly, JMP Securities raised their price target for DoorDash to $225, highlighting the company’s consistent top-line growth and potential for EBITDA compounding. These are all recent developments for DoorDash, reflecting positive market sentiment towards the company’s financial performance and future prospects.
